Here are some pictures of the Genuine VW Doglegs we carry compared to the Danish one:

Image may have been reduced in size. Click image to view fullscreen.


Image may have been reduced in size. Click image to view fullscreen.


Image may have been reduced in size. Click image to view fullscreen.


Image may have been reduced in size. Click image to view fullscreen.



Here's a link to our classified ad where we talk about it some more: http://www.thesamba.com/vw/classifieds/detail.php?id=778901

The difference in quality is amazing - the Genuine VW one weighs 9.75lbs, while the Danish one weighs 6.25lbs. You can see the quality difference clearly enough I don't even have to note which one is the Genuine VW item.

lostsailr wrote:
So, that VW dogleg has a diagonal plate attached the other doesn't. as We removed our original, there was no soch apendage. IS that a newer version, or was the old one just disolved away?


I used those doglegs on my bus. I ended up having to cut that plate off cause it was hitting the bottom of the floor and would not let it go into place. Took it off and it slipped in like butta. I did have to do some tweeking to it to get it right but it fit real well once in place. I'm so glad I paid the extra for them instead of waiting for the cheaper ones.
